While Bollywood or Hollywood actively market “couple goals” from real-life pairs (e.g., Ranveer-Deepika), Bangladesh’s conservative social context makes such openness rare. Instead, on-screen romantic storylines often rely on idealized, chaste love, while off-screen relationships face scrutiny, rumors, and occasional scandal.
While high-profile relationships can boost a star's visibility, they come with a double-edged sword. In a society that is still navigating the balance between tradition and modernity, Bangladeshi actresses often face disproportionate scrutiny compared to their male counterparts. A breakup or a controversial relationship can lead to intense social media trolling, which sometimes impacts their brand endorsements and professional opportunities. Conclusion
